Spice Up Your Date Nights

Looking for a way to add some excitement to your date nights? Why not try something new and unique that you’ve never done before? Whether it’s a cooking class where you can learn how to make exotic dishes or a paint-and-sip class where you can let your creative juices flow, there are countless options to choose from. Or, if you’re feeling adventurous, consider trying something more daring, like bungee jumping or rock climbing. 

Surprise your partner by planning something special and unique that you both can enjoy together. Whatever you choose, a fun and unique experience is sure to liven up your date nights and create unforgettable memories together. 

Take A Weekend Getaway to A Destination

Life can get a little monotonous sometimes, especially if you’ve been in a relationship for a while. So why not spice things up by taking a weekend getaway to somewhere you’ve never been before? It doesn’t have to be far away – it could be a neighboring city or state. The important thing is that you’re exploring somewhere new together. It’s a great way to bond and create new shared memories. Additionally, getting away from the daily grind can help both of you relax and recharge so that when you come back to reality, your relationship is stronger than before. Plus, who knows what kind of adventures await in an unfamiliar destination? So pack your bags, hit the road, and get ready to make some unforgettable memories.

Express Appreciation for Your Partner by Complimenting Them

Being in a long-term relationship or marriage can sometimes feel unexciting, and you may find yourself getting bored. It’s essential to express appreciation for your partner, even during the mundane moments of life. A simple compliment when they least expect it can bring a smile to their face and reignite the spark in your relationship. Take note of the small things they do; perhaps they cooked an excellent meal or folded the laundry without being asked, and tell them how much you appreciate it. Taking the time to show your appreciation and complimenting your partner, even when they are least expecting it, can make a world of difference in strengthening your bond and reigniting the passion in your marriage.

Make An Effort to Show Your Lover That You Care About Them

When you truly care about someone, you want to show it in meaningful ways. Sometimes it’s the small gestures that can make the biggest impact on your partner’s day. One way to demonstrate your love and appreciation is by doing something specific that shows you’ve been paying attention to their likes and dislikes. For instance, preparing their favorite meal or taking care of a task that they’ve been dreading can lift their spirits and make them feel special. These acts of kindness can strengthen your bond and create lasting memories for both of you. It all starts with showing that you care enough to go the extra mile. Moreover, these small gestures can remind your partner of why they chose you in the first place.
